Geographic Location of Bharaj


The village Bharaj is located in Ambejogai Tahsil of Beed District in the State of Maharashtra in India. It comes under Ambejogai Community Development Block. The nearest town is Ambejogai, which is about 12 kilometers away from Bharaj.

Travel and Communication for Bharaj


The village is connected by public bus services. There is a railway station more than 10 kms away from the village.

Social Structure of Bharaj


As per available data from the year 2009, 1584 persons live in 312 house holds in the village Bharaj. There are 764 female individuals and 820 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 48.23% and males constitute 51.77% of the total population.

There are 235 scheduled castes persons of which 120 are females and 115 are males. Females constitute 51.06% and males constitute 48.94%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 14.84% of the total population.

There are 10 scheduled tribes persons of which 5 are females and 5 are males. Females constitute 50% and males constitute 50%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 0.63% of the total population.

Population density of Bharaj is 184.19 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Bharaj

Total area of Bharaj is 860 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 826 ha. About 58 ha is un-irrigated area. About 768 ha is irrigated area. About 58 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ells.

About 2 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 2 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ands.

About 30 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.

Schools in Bharaj


There are 2 government pre-primary schools in the village Bharaj.

There are 2 government primary schools in the village Bharaj.

There is a government middle school in the village Bharaj.

There is a private secondary school in the village Bharaj.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a government senior secondary school in Bharaj Phata, which is more than 10 kms away from Bharaj.
